Stacks is a layer-1 blockchain solution that is designed to bring smart contracts and decentralized applications (DApps) to Bitcoin (BTC). These smart contracts are brought to Bitcoin without changing any of the features that make it so powerful — including its security and stability.

By utilizing the advanced scalability of the Solana blockchain, Zeta provides features and performance comparable to centralized exchanges (CEX), while maintaining the self-custodial nature and transparency inherent to DEXs. ZEX is the governance token of the Zeta platform, granting holders governance rights as well as a share in ongoing trading and staking incentives. This structure is designed to align the long-term interests of the protocol with those of the community.
